Book Synopsis
Water confidence doesn't begin at swim lessons.
It begins at home.
Prepare2Swim: Ready Go is a parent-guided introduction to early water confidence for babies and toddlers - designed to support children from their very first bath through early pool experiences, long before formal swim lessons begin.
Written by veteran swim instructors and parents Michael and Dale Godleski, this book focuses on something more foundational than strokes or drills: how children learn to feel safe in water - and how a parent's presence, pacing, and emotional regulation shape that relationship from the very beginning.
With over 25 years of experience teaching children and guiding thousands of families, the authors present a calm-first framework rooted in child development, nervous system regulation, and practical water safety principles.
This is not a competitive swim manual.
It is not a checklist of drills.
Instead, it helps parents understand:
- How babies and toddlers build trust with water
- Why early exposure must be predictable and calm
- How back comfort and breath regulation support safety
- How to prevent fear before it forms
- Why regulation always comes before skill
The opening section speaks directly to parents, explaining the developmental science behind early water learning. The illustrated story that follows is designed to be read together and revisited over time - helping children become familiar with water in a way that feels intentional, calm, and safe as they grow.
This approach supports families from infancy through the preschool years - whether you're holding a baby in the tub or guiding a toddler at the edge of a pool.
Optional QR codes are included for families who want additional guidance, but the book stands fully on its own.
Parents describe it as calm, practical, and reassuring - especially for families introducing babies and toddlers to water for the first time.
The impact of these early foundations often becomes clear years later - when swim lessons feel easier, confidence builds faster, and fear never had the chance to take hold.
